Pen pressure is gone after latest Photoshop update on Windows

  • September 11, 2020
  • 2 replies
  • 506 views

My pen pressure doesn't work anymore. I have updated photoshop and it is now up to day. I have reset the Pref settings but no matter what I do the pen pressure is just not responding. I don't know what to do anymore.

 

It happened while my laptop (windows) was updating and I accidentally pressed a key somewhere on the left side of my keyboard ( don't know which one sadly ). Then most of my windows disappeared ( pens settings, brushes stuff like that ) and Camera Raw pop up. I couldn't close it or interect with it. I had to restart my laptop and since then the pressure doesn't respond anymore.

 

I already did the PSUserConfig.txt UseSystemStylus 0 trick but that doesn't seem to work. please help! my incom depents on this 😞

Unfortunately turning on Windows Ink is only a partial solution. If you use your pen for resizing the cursor, there's now a huge lag on it.

I think Adobe should go back to the PSUserConfig.txt solution to fix the problem. At least that worked properly. Failing that Adobe should do better testing of their updates.

WinTab support is fixed in the 21.2.3 update.  You do not have to use INK.

We're sorry about the trouble with pen pressure in Photoshop. Would you mind telling us which drawing tablet are you using? Did you install all the pending Windows updates after restarting the laptop?

 

Please remove the PSUserconfig file you created and enable Windows INK in the tablet drivers. You can also check: https://helpx.adobe.com/photoshop/kb/tablet-support-faq-photoshop.html
